I see this bug report:
http://nagoya.apache.org/bugzilla/show_bug.cgi?id=8625

I too am having issues with UseCanonical for serveraliased sites.

In order for my redirects to use the Host header, I have to set UseCanonical to 
Off.  But setting UseCanonical to off forces the use of the internal port 
number...

We use a load balancer, and must run apache on different ports for some SSLed 
sites.

UseCanonical off:
        Location: http://a.a.com:4014/hello/  ; right server alias, wrong port
UseCanonical on:
        Location: http://www.a.com/hello/    ; right port, incorrect serverAlias

I want a new flag added to UseCanonical:
        UseCanonical  ServerPortOnly
Or a less indirect way, pass the servername or port to use to UseCanonical:
        UseCanonical :80

This enhancement will use the Host header and the Port Directive value.

UseCanonical :80
        Location: http://a.a.com/hello/   ; right port, right serverAlias
